Active Gloucestershire recognises the important role that sports clubs play within the Gloucestershire community in enabling and encouraging people of all ages, ability and backgrounds to participate in sport and Physical Activity.

This section of the Active Gloucestershire website provides information and guidance to local clubs across the County in the following areas:

Clubmark

A National accreditation scheme that’s sets the standard for clubs to ensure quality club provision for children and young people.

Active Gloucestershire Club Standards

A set of Child Welfare and Protection Standards for clubs that offer opportunities for young people. A great first step for clubs working towards Clubmark.

Club Templates

Download useful templates required for Gloucestershire Club Standards and Clubmark.

Club Development Workshops

Specific workshops tailored to addressing key issues faced by sports clubs and those required for Gloucestershire Club Standards and Clubmark. Find out when and where courses are being run.

Funding

Various funding opportunities are available for sports clubs which can assist with sport and physical activity projects.

Inclusive Clubs

Support and guidance on how your club can include disabled people including information on the Disability Discrimination Act (DDA) and what this means to your club.
